Comparison of the Elixhauser and Charlson/Deyo Methods of Comorbidity Measurement in Administrative Data

Medical Care · 2004 · Vol. 42(4) · pp. 355–360

Abstract

The Elixhauser comorbidity measurement method performs better than the widely used Charlson/Deyo method in the Canadian acute MI cases studied.
